Ever since its launch in 2008, the Indian Premier League (IPL) has almost become a celebration, of our country’s love for cricket. Such has become the fervor around the sporting league that it is looked at as one of the biggest marketing opportunities for brands.

Over the years, the league has become a crucial event which sees a massive advertising spend. And why not? The tournament gives brands an opportunity to reach out to a massive, engaged set of audience who are glued to their television sets for the entirety of the tournament. A lot of marketing monies are spent during the season. Last year, IPL had helped broadcaster Star India to earn around Rs 2000 crore in advertising revenue.

Therefore, when the league got postponed due to the coronavirus pandemic this year, not only the audience, but the brands mourned too. Meanwhile, political tensions in the country also led to the dropping out of Vivo.

However, with the league finally happening, things are slowly warming up. Many brands have already come on board as sponsors and the league has definitely not lost its sheen even in a year that has been very difficult. This year is expected to bring a higher viewership too and therefore advertisers are expected to go all out to make the most out of the league.
